CartPause
CartPause

A 72-hour pause between you and any online purchase

0 upvotes🎨 AI Image & DesignJun 2026

CartPause is a unique productivity and financial management tool designed to help online shoppers curb impulsive spending. By adding a mandatory 72-hour pause between selecting an item and completing the purchase, it encourages thoughtful decision-making. Users simply share products from any online store—Amazon, Target, Walmart, and more—into the app, which then starts a customizable timer. During this period, users can reflect on whether they truly need the item, leading to smarter financial choices and reduced impulse buys. With 73% of paused items never purchased, it significantly boosts savings, averaging around $2,400 annually for members. The tool's simplicity, privacy focus, and ad-free experience make it accessible and appealing to anyone looking to improve their shopping habits and financial discipline.

Stitch 2.0 by Google
Stitch 2.0 by Google

Vibe design beautiful production-ready UI in seconds

841 upvotes🎨 AI Image & DesignMar 2026

Stitch 2.0 by Google is an innovative AI-native design tool that streamlines the creation of high-fidelity user interfaces. It empowers designers, developers, and product teams to generate beautiful, production-ready UI using natural language commands, voice, and context-aware agents. The platform supports designing across images, code, and text seamlessly within a single canvas, enabling users to iterate rapidly and produce prototypes instantly. Its integration of built-in design systems and the DESIGN.md format ensures consistency and efficiency, making the transition from idea to interface faster than ever. Ideal for teams seeking a smarter, more intuitive approach to UI design, Stitch 2.0 combines AI-driven automation with collaborative features to enhance productivity and creativity.
